What Home Improvements Add the Most Value
When it comes to adding worth to your home, the professionals in real estate will concur that to capitalise in the bathroom as well as cooking area almost certainly ensures successful returns.
If you're thinking about making your residence appealing to prospective customers, after that one of the top places to begin is in the restroom. With many devices and appliances on the market, choosing that will ultimately enable you to gain the rewards is discouraging.
When it comes to shower room layout, what is it that many people actually want? Would picking a spacious whirlpool bath above a standard bath be economically helpful in the long haul?
Wouldn't creating your washroom be a much easier task if you were equipped with a standard of what tickled the fancy of prospective buyers? If you're mosting likely to design your shower room get it right the very first time round to stay clear of flushing away hard-earned pounds.

Restroom floor covering


Attempt to avoid the urge to position rugs on the restroom flooring, according to the study it is not as well favoured. The study revealed that the favored flooring covering was floor tiles, with 75 percent claiming they "enjoyed" a tiled washroom floor. Popular vinyl flooring has not yet lost its place in the restroom, with more than 61 per cent saying they didn't have any strong sort or disapproval towards it.
When choosing your washroom floor covering, floor tiles is the favoured choice, however if the budget plan is tight, then vinyl floor covering will not allow you down.
Besides the floor covering, make certain your windows look appealing. When it concerns dressing your bathroom windows, stay away from those washroom webs as well as material curtains. The survey revealed that 94 percent stated they favoured blinds in the restroom to curtains.

Shower power


When planning the layout of your washroom, among the most important aspects to take into consideration is putting a shower. Some restrooms don't have ample area to include a shower cubicle, so analyze your alternatives. Think about installing a shower over the bath if room is limited.
The survey revealed that 94 percent of its participants thought that a shower in a shower room was very vital, and also 81 per cent said they favored a separate shower enclosure in a huge restroom. Almost 65 percent stated their ideal would certainly be a power shower, while 27 per cent preferred mixer showers, and also only 12 percent selected electric showers.
If you have actually selected a shower over the bath, after that think of putting a fixed glass display rather than a shower curtain. It might cost a couple of additional pounds, yet over half of the survey's factors preferred a set glass screen to a shower drape.

Selecting your tub


In contrast to common idea, adding a whirlpool bath to boost residential or commercial property worth doesn't constantly do the trick. So if you're considering selling your residential property, try to prevent purchasing a whirlpool bath in the hopes of getting additional revenue.
The study exposed that near 53 per cent of its individuals were not phased by them, while only a little 38 percent of participants "enjoyed" them. Surprisingly, 62 percent claimed they had "no strong sight" towards corner bathrooms either, which implies the standard rectangle-shaped baths still hold authority against their fixed up counter components.

Hello simpleness


From as far back as the 1960s much emphasis was placed on strong colour in the washroom. Patterned wall surface floor tiles of nautical animals and also over-the-top colours were the pattern, in addition to plastic. Plastic bathroom design was the fad, from bold orange, olive eco-friendly, mustard yellow and also chocolate brownish coloured toothbrush, soap as well as towel owners, to thick formed plastic shower curtains that yelled colours of the boldest nature.
As the moments went on, the 1970s and early 1980s came to be a duration when gold bathroom mendings and also equipping, such as taps, towel rails and toilet roll holders, were taken into consideration really stylish. These ostentatious gold trimmed functions were in vogue, and also bathroom decoration was 'loud'. Contributed to this were those when fascinating washroom collections in colours avocado, coral pink, and chocolate brown. Restroom colour has actually altered substantially over the past years, and also tones have actually become more neutral, sometimes with a hint of colour that adds a complementary vigour to the overall scheme.
Of the many hundreds of people who took part in Plumbworld's recent bathroom survey, an overwhelming 82 per cent said they "despised" the as soon as pietistic avocado and also reefs pink washroom collections, colours residue of 1970s and 1980s, which are generally characterised as being dark and plain.
According to the study, chrome washroom faucets were much liked to gold.
So, when creating as well as embellishing your restroom keep those dark colours away, take into consideration white collections, and also go with chrome correctings and also home furnishings as opposed to showy gold.

Maintain it tidy


If you are intending to place your house on the market, inspect your bathroom for those tiny usually undetected imperfections, like mould on the silicone sealer around the bathroom, as well as even on your shower curtain if you have one. Potential homebuyers may notice these little faults, which could send out after that running!

How To Design Small Bathrooms


few months ago I wrote a blog on how to design a general perfect bathroom. So continuing from that let’s have a look now on how to design small bathrooms. As let’s be honest here, how many of you have got a big or a good size bathroom in your home? Well, I guess not many, and as matter of fact, many of the bathrooms in an average house are quite small. When we design our client’ bathrooms we always find many challenges to take in consideration and issue to solve. So let’s consider some design tips that can help you to make the most of your space without compromising on the essential but still give the illusion of spaciousness!



The secret of how to design small bathroom is all in the planning, and the smallest space the more this needs to be well thought. Hence prioritise what is most important to you. Don’t forget about the negative space that you need around you in order to move and not having to hit another piece of furniture or object. That will hand up in screaming and frustration every time that you will use the bathroom! So consider well where you are going to position your basin, toilet and bath or shower and think that with these will follow also accessories and they need to be taken into consideration in terms of space too.


Tiles, units & brassware


Be smart when you choose your tiles. Try and select large, plain tiles for the wall for instance with a different colour version of the flooring. If you can, avoid too many patterns. If you do choose patterns do only or for the walls or the floor and not both as this will make the space feel cramped.



Try and clear the floor as much as you can. Therefore, if you want to make the room feel bigger opt for wall-mounted units. These are handy also when it comes to cleaning – always think at the practical side too!



Also, choosing the right brassware can make a difference in terms of spatial illusion. In fact, wall-mounted taps and shower mixer with a concealed body are a nice way for reducing the visual clutter and making the space feel larger.


Storage


Always a big issue when it comes to bathroom and one aspect that people often forget. You look at the beautiful pictures on Pinterest or magazine where there is just one small bottle on display. In reality, doesn’t really work like this. You all are going to have toilet paper packs, shower gel, soap bottles and a lot of more stuff that you need for your everyday use. Thus when planning your bathroom think form the start how you can create the extra space and plan ahead for fitted niches or conceal cupboards withing stud walls. Also try and get vanity unit with drawers or cabinet that are quite spacious where you can put things and not only look pretty!



When it comes to heating underfloor heating is a good solution and space efficient. Or use towel rails, which can also be used for heating too.



If you are a bath person and not having the right space for a full-size tub why don’t consider Bijou style baths that usually are smaller in length and also so pretty!



When it comes to saving space people don’t consider doors. Using sliding or pocket doors can be a good free up layout option. Or if you still want to keep the standard door, then make sure that you hang it so the swing is outside the room!



Last but not least don’t forget of course to add a good size mirror. This is the most simple trick for creating the illusion of more space and also can help to spread the lights around.
